America's Role in Nation-Building is a nearly 50-year review of U.S. efforts to transform defeated and broken enemies into democratic and prosperous allies. The authors identify key determinants of success in terms of democratization and the creation of vibrant economies. Seven case studies are examined: Germany, Japan, Somalia, Haiti, Bosnia, Kosovo, and Afghanistan. Presents lessons learned from each of these operations and draws implications for future U.S. nation-building operations, including Iraq. The authors conclude that rebuilding Iraq will be difficult but possible, and use historical perspective to illuminate today's headlines.
